Asdabbi Rainbow Butterfly Memories

After the first time Asdabbi and I met, I was able to call on him to meet me by thinking very hard about him. He taught me how to do it and it normally took him a day to find me, but when he did, I showed my curiosity towards him and asked as many questions as I could about his life.

Asdabbi the rainbow butterfly can remember what it was like as a caterpillar. There is one tragedy in his life that he will never forget. This was the time when the black birds attacked his brothers and sisters.

He said he was awoken to the cries of his brothers and sisters. He looked out and saw big black crows pecking at the ground and ripping up rainbow caterpillars.

He says it is the type of tragedy you have to live through to understand. I can only imagine how scary that morning must have been.

He told me how scared he was and how he couldn’t move. He mentioned later that he felt bad about not helping anyone but himself, but he was froze with fear.

This feeling was later removed when he ran into two of his brothers and one of his sisters in a butterfly sanctuary. They each travelled there after they awoke as rainbow butterflies.

Each of his siblings said they felt bad for staying as still as possible until the birds flew away. They all shared that feeling, but that feeling of fright was replaced with a feeling of excitement for the future because now they could share adventures together as a family.

I asked him what it was like to wake up as a rainbow butterfly. He told me about discovering his wings, his rainbow butterfly backpack, his manual on becoming a magical rainbow butterfly, and his copy of the Butterfly Migration Cycle (BMC) magazine.

All of these things were very important to him and all rainbow butterflies.

The first thing he noticed after he tore from his cocoon was his butterfly wings . He wasn’t even sure what they were for. As he thought about it, the rainbow butterfly backpack he was wearing became a little heavier.

He didn’t even know he was wearing a backpack until it increased in weight and made itself known. He opened it and saw a book called, “Becoming a Magical Rainbow Butterfly…for beginners.”

He opened the book to the marked page and read all about his wings. He found out what they were for and how to use them. He found out that it is a butterfly’s wings that make them different than all the other butterflies.

Then he wondered where he was suppose to go with these wings and the backpack again became heavier. He opened the backpack and put the book back in it and took out his copy of the BMC magazine that had just magically appeared in there.

Then once again the backpack became lighter like it was holding nothing at all.

Inside the magazine he found a route to follow called the butterfly migration cycle and it pointed out all of the scenic spots you would see along the route.

Following the cycle is how he met up with his brothers and sister; Alanabbi, Justinabbi, and Bisdyabbi and met many other butterflies, people, and other creatures.

I asked him what it was like to be a rainbow butterfly. He looked at me with his proboscis sticking out, which a butterfly sticks their tongue (proboscis) out when they smile and are truly happy, and gave me the best butterfly smile you can imagine.

“What’s not to like as a rainbow butterfly,” I stated and questioned all at the same time.

He explained how rainbow butterflies can learn different magic tricks from their butterfly manuals. They can cheer up anybody in need of cheering up. They can speak to any creature. They can fly the wind anywhere they want to go.

Each rainbow butterfly has a special skill that none of the other butterflies, including other rainbow butterflies, have. Some are better at planning like his brother, Alandabbi.

Some are better at picking up on vibrations from sad creatures and have more empathy than the others like his sister, Bisdyabbi.

Some are stronger and faster than others like his other brother, Justinabbi.

Some rainbow butterflies can change their color, look like other butterflies, and even camouflage into his or her surroundings.

Asdabbi said the best part about being a rainbow butterfly was that he could talk to any other creature and they could understand each other.

“Being a rainbow butterfly allows me to make life more fun and enjoyable for everyone that I meet,” I remember Asdabbi saying before we parted ways this time.

The little guy shared many stories with me about his adventures. I will tell you more about them next time.
